Making Recreation Accessible to All

The Foundation transforms lives through elevating the goals and ideals of the Fox Valley Special Recreation Association.  Founded in 2010, the Foundation had supported initiatives such as the Carolyn Nagle Sensory Room, Dr. William Kelly Resource Library, Hardship Grants, Break Bags, SootheSpace, and has many new projects to come.

Through sponsorships and partnerships, hundreds of fundraising events, individual giving, and more, the Foundation enriches the lives of individuals with disabilities and families and helps them enjoy healthy, active, and fulfilling lives.

Committees of Involvement
  • The Community Outreach Committee will spread FVSRF’s mission by being an ambassador for the Foundation and Association.  Monthly Chamber of Commerce and community events will be posted, and Board of Shining Star members can select which events they would like to attend.
  • The Community Cares Committee supports FVSRA families and staff through various initiatives aimed at enhancing well-being, providing resources, and fostering a supportive environment. The Community Cares committee also provides yearly Therapeutic Recreation Scholarships to future Recreation Specialists.
  • The Community Fundraising Committee assists the Development Coordinator in planning and running fundraising events to effectively support the financial stability and growth of the foundation. Having a diverse committee with varied skills and connections is essential for maximizing fundraising potential-so all talents are welcome and valued.

Community Impact

Around $20,000 annually for program scholarships
$100,000 to launch SootheSpace to make the community more inclusive
Athletic Uniforms, Equipment, and State Tournament Subsidy for those competing in Special Olympic programs
